Randy Orton Responds To NXT Superstar Tommaso Ciampa Using One Of His Signature Moves

Last night on NXT, Tommaso Ciampa attacked champion Aleister Black and hit him with a very familiar-looking DDT. This was called to Randy Orton's attention on Twitter, and The Viper issued a short response...

Tommaso Ciampa hit Johnny Gargano with a DDT as he was climbing through the ropes to win their match at NXT TakeOver, and it seems like "The Blackheart" might be taking this as one of his signature moves from now on, as he hit Aleister Black with the same draping DDT last night on NXT.

Though not exactly the same, this is very similar to Randy Orton's hanging DDT - something which was called to The Viper's attention over Twitter.



Orton probably isn't too pissed off about this, but still, it wouldn't be surprising if we didn't see Ciampa using that move again!
